For the first time this winter, Rock Hill played a strong fourth period, outscoring Gallipolis 27-9 after trailing most of the game.

The Redmen improved to 3-5. Rock Hill has about five players who are in the third year on the varsity. After GAHS controlled the game's tempo for nearly three quarters, the Redmen dominated the final eight minutes.

Rock Hill's reserve squad dropped to 6-2 after a 43-40 loss to the GAHS JVs. Little Redmen have lots of size, but about three of them are juniors.
